One of the key aspects of legal compliance for businesses in Sweden is data protection and privacy laws. With the introduction of the GDPR (General Data Protection Regulation), companies are required to implement robust data protection measures to safeguard customer data and ensure compliance with the strict guidelines set forth by the European Union. Businesses utilizing cutting-edge technologies must pay close attention to data privacy laws to avoid costly penalties and maintain customer trust. Another crucial area that businesses in Sweden must navigate is intellectual property rights. Companies that develop innovative products or technologies need to protect their intellectual property through patents, trademarks, and copyrights to prevent unauthorized use or infringement. By proactively managing their intellectual property rights, companies can secure their competitive advantage and ensure long-term growth and success. When it comes to marketing exceptional technologies and products in Sweden, companies must adhere to advertising and consumer protection laws. The Swedish Consumer Agency sets strict guidelines for advertising practices to prevent false or misleading claims and protect consumers from deceptive marketing tactics. By following these regulations, businesses can build consumer trust and establish a solid reputation in the market. Moreover, businesses operating in Sweden must also comply with labor laws and employment regulations to ensure fair treatment of employees and maintain a positive work environment. By upholding labor standards and promoting workplace safety, companies can attract top talent, enhance employee productivity, and mitigate legal risks associated with non-compliance.
